I have a 2009 Camry, always do its maintenance in Toyota dealer every 5000 miles. Its current mileage is 23,000 miles.

A few days ago, my daughter drove it to local post office (3 miles away) and came back with a bare rim in left front wheel (driver side). Its tire fell off totally from the wheel. She was so shocked and felt panic for the day. Luckily that is within local street where traffic is not heavy and speed is not high. Should this happen while anyone driving it on the highway, he or she might lose their life.

I have had a few times tire punctured incidents in the past, but I never have any experiences to see a tire totally falling off from the wheel. Neither had I heard anyone that I know had this kind of horrible story. Maybe in movies, but never in real life.

Toyota Motor has been through quality downgrade for the past few years.  Numerous quality complaints and recalls make me wonder what is going on with the company. I am not sure if I shall keep my faith in it.
